home *** CD-ROM | disk | FTP | other *** search
/ Tiger Disk 39 / Tiger_Disk_039_1997-06_Tiger-Crew-Disk_de_Side_B.d64 / print 64 (.txt) < prev    next >
Commodore BASIC  |  2023-02-26  |  1KB  |  47 lines

  1. 10 poke56,64:clr
  2. 12 poke 3231,16* 5+ 0:rem fore+back(31)
  3. 20 print"[147]print 8k prg bitmap file"
  4. 21 print"home = reverse   l = load"
  5. 22 print"   p = print     x = exit"
  6. 24 input"fn = ";n$
  7. 26 poke 3228,len(n$):rem len  (28)
  8. 28 sys 3237         :rem load (37)
  9. 30 poke53265,59
  10. 40 poke53272,128
  11. 50 poke53280,0      :rem border
  12. 60 poke56576,150
  13. 90 sys 3240         :rem init (40)
  14. 100 getc$:ifc$=""goto100
  15. 120 ifc$<>""goto130
  16. 122 sys 3243:goto100:rem flip (43)
  17. 130 ifc$<>"p"goto300
  18. 140 close3:open3,4
  19. 142 print#3,chr$(8);:goto160
  20. 150 fori=1to1:print#3:next
  21. 160 forj=0to28
  22. 170 fork=0to39
  23. 180 sys 3246        :rem prnt (46)
  24. 190 a$=""
  25. 200 fori=0to7
  26. 210 a=peek( 3200+i) :rem char (0)
  27. 220 a$=a$+chr$(a)
  28. 230 nexti
  29. 240 ifk<>39thenprint#3,a$;:goto260
  30. 250 print#3,a$:goto260
  31. 252 print#3,chr$(27);chr$(10);chr$(2);
  32. 260 nextk                :rem gap=0,2,3
  33. 270 nextj
  34. 280 fori=1to4:print#3:next:rem bl=4,2,1
  35. 282 print#3,chr$(15);
  36. 284 close3
  37. 290 goto100
  38. 300 ifc$="l"thengosub900:goto20
  39. 310 ifc$="x"thengosub900:end
  40. 500 goto100
  41. 900 poke53265,27
  42. 910 poke53272,21
  43. 920 poke53280,254
  44. 930 poke56576,151
  45. 940 print"[147]"
  46. 950 return
  47.